55 Bangladeshis among 338 workers held in Malaysia raid

block

The Star Online, Petaling Jaya :
A total of 338 foreigners including 55 Bangladeshis were detained after immigration officers raided a factory in Cyberjaya, says Mustafar Ali, director general of Malaysian Immigration Department.
